AAR Class: T: Tank Car. Tank car means any car which is used only for the transportation of liquids, liquefied gases, compressed gases, or solids that are liquefied prior to unloading. Car may be without underframe if container serving as superstructure is designed to serve as underframe. If car has underframe, it must be designed only for the carriage of one or more enclosed containers (with or without compartments) that form the superstructure and are integral parts of the car.

Remnants of the PRR Octoraro Branch
Title:  Remnants of the PRR Octoraro Branch
Description:  We're at the end of the line for the active portion of the former Octoraro Branch in Nottingham, Pennsylvania, now owned by the Penn Eastern Rail Lines, Inc. The line south from here into Maryland and on to a connection with the NS (ex-CR, exx-PC, exxx-PRR) Port Road (Harrisburg, Pa. to Perryville, Md.) is long abandoned.
